Abstract

This research aimed to develop a physical activities learning model (MPAF) based on critical thinking skills (CTS) among children aged 5 to 6 years old and to evaluate its validity, practicality or commitment, and effectiveness in implementing the CTS based -MPAF among those children. The data were collected from 14 students of TK (Kindergarten) Negeri Pembina Surabaya through both qualitative and quantitative methods. The finding revealed that teachers played a vital role in learning process and could be confirmed by a successful achievement of valid, practical and effective critical thinking according to the determined standards. Conclusion: CTS based - MPAF can successfully work if the teachers precisely realize the learning principles in early childhood education and CTS based - syntax referred to available references.
